Stanley Ukridge ensnares the narrator in another one of his schemes: running a chicken farm in the English countryside.

***

Wodehouse once described his writing as "musical comedy without music," and Love Among the Chickens is one of the earliest examples of his trademark style. The narrator, Jeremy Garnet, is a mild-mannered author attempting to finish his next novel in peace and quiet. Enter Stanley Ukridge, a man brimming with endless schemes, who draws the narrator into his latest, "the idea of a lifetime" - running a chicken farm.
